| custom_headers |
Dict[str, str] |
Custom HTTP headers attached to every notification delivered by this webhook (max 10). Header names must be valid RFC 7230 tokens (printable ASCII, no separators), are treated case-insensitively (duplicate names differing only in case are rejected), and may not exceed 128 characters. The following names are reserved and cannot be used: Host, Content-Type, Content-Length, Transfer-Encoding, Connection, User-Agent, Accept, Accept-Encoding, Fireblocks-Signature, Fireblocks-Webhook-Signature. Header values are write-only — never returned in responses. |
[optional] |
